Freigeben über


Primäre APPC-Rückgabecodes

0000

AP_OK
Das Verb wurde erfolgreich ausgeführt.

0001

AP_PARAMETER_CHECK
Das Verb wurde aufgrund eines Parameterfehlers nicht ausgeführt.

0002

AP_STATE_CHECK
Das Verb wurde nicht ausgeführt, weil es in einem ungültigen Zustand ausgegeben wurde.

0003

AP_ZUORDNUNGSFEHLER
APPC konnte eine Unterhaltung nicht zuordnen. Der Gesprächszustand ist auf "reset" festgelegt.

Dieser Code kann über ein Verb zurückgegeben werden, das nach ALLOCATE oder MC_ALLOCATE ausgegeben wurde.

0005

AP_DEALLOC_ABEND (für eine abgebildete Sitzung)
Die Unterhaltung wurde aus einem der folgenden Gründe umgestellt:

  • Das Partnertransaktionsprogramm (TP) hat MC_DEALLOCATE ausgestellt und dealloc_type auf AP_ABEND festgelegt.

  • Der Partner TP ist auf einen ABEND gestoßen, was dazu führte, dass die logische Partnereinheit (LU) eine MC_DEALLOCATE Anforderung gesendet hat.

0006

AP_DEALLOC_ABEND_PROG (für eine einfache Unterhaltung)
Die Unterhaltung wurde aus einem der folgenden Gründe umgestellt:

  • Der Partner-TP hat DEALLOCATE ausgeführt, wobei dealloc_type auf AP_ABEND_PROG gesetzt ist.

  • Der Partner TP hat einen ABEND gefunden, wodurch der Partner LU eine DEALLOCATE-Anforderung sendet.

0007

AP_DEALLOC_ABEND_SVC (für eine grundlegende Kommunikation)
Die Unterhaltung wurde zugeordnet, da der Partner TP DEALLOCATE mit dealloc_type auf AP_ABEND_SVC festgelegt hat.

0008

AP_DEALLOC_ABEND_TIMER (für eine einfache Unterhaltung)
Die Unterhaltung wurde zugeordnet, da der Partner TP DEALLOCATE mit dealloc_type auf AP_ABEND_TIMER festgelegt hat.

0009

AP_DEALLOC_NORMAL
Der Partner TP hat die Unterhaltung ohne eine Bestätigung anzufordern deallokiert.

000C

AP_PROG_ERROR_NO_TRUNC
Der Partner-TP hat eines der folgenden Verben ausgegeben, während sich die Unterhaltung im SEND-Zustand befand:

000F

AP_CONV_FAILURE_RETRY
Die Unterhaltung wurde aufgrund eines temporären Fehlers beendet. Starten Sie den TP neu, um festzustellen, ob das Problem erneut auftritt. Wenn dies der Fall ist, sollte der Systemadministrator das Fehlerprotokoll untersuchen, um die Ursache des Fehlers zu ermitteln.

0010

AP_CONV_FAILURE_NO_RETRY
Die Unterhaltung wurde aufgrund eines andauernden Umstands, wie z. B. eines Sitzungsprotokollfehlers, beendet. Der Systemadministrator sollte das Systemfehlerprotokoll untersuchen, um die Ursache des Fehlers zu ermitteln. Wiederholen Sie die Unterhaltung erst, wenn der Fehler behoben wurde.

0011

AP_SVC_ERROR_NO_TRUNC
Im SEND-Zustand hat der Partner TP (oder die Partner-LU) SEND_ERROR ausgestellt, wobei err_type auf AP_SVC festgelegt ist. Daten wurden nicht abgeschnitten.

0012

AP_PROG_ERROR_TRUNC/AP_SVC_ERROR_TRUNC
Im SEND-Zustand hat der Partner TP nach dem Senden eines unvollständigen logischen Datensatzes SEND_ERROR ausgestellt. Der erste Teil des logischen Datensatzes könnte vom lokalen TP empfangen worden sein.

0013

AP_SVC_ERROR_PURGING
Der Partner-TP (oder Partner-LU) hat SEND_ERROR ausgestellt, wobei err_type auf AP_SVC festgelegt ist, während er sich im Status "RECEIVE", "PENDING_POST", "CONFIRM", "CONFIRM_SEND" oder "CONFIRM_DEALLOCATE" befindet. Die an den Partner-TP gesendeten Daten wurden möglicherweise gelöscht.

0014

AP_ERFOLGLOS
Vom Partner TP sind keine Daten sofort verfügbar.

0017

AP_CNOS_LOCAL_RACE_REJECT
APPC verarbeitet derzeit ein CNOS-Verb , das von einer lokalen LU ausgegeben wird.

0018

AP_CNOS_PARTNER_LU_REJECT (AP_CNOS_PARTNER_LU_ABGELEHNT)
Die Partner-LU hat eine CNOS-Anforderung von der lokalen LU abgelehnt.

0019

AP_GESPRÄCHSTYP_GEMISCHT
Das TP hat sowohl grundlegende als auch zugeordnete Gesprächsverben bereitgestellt. In einer einzigen Unterhaltung kann nur ein Typ ausgegeben werden.

0021

AP_ABGEBROCHEN
Der lokale TP hat eines der folgenden Verben ausgegeben, das RECEIVE_AND_POST oder MC_RECEIVE_AND_POST abgebrochen hat:

F002

AP_TP_BUSY
Der lokale TP hat einen Aufruf an APPC ausgegeben, während APPC einen anderen Aufruf für denselben TP verarbeitet hat. Dies kann auftreten, wenn das lokale TP über mehrere Threads verfügt und mehrere Threads APPC-Aufrufe mit demselben tp_id ausgeben.

F003

AP_COMM_SUBSYSTEM_ABENDED
Gibt eine der folgenden Bedingungen an:

  • Der von dieser Unterhaltung verwendete Knoten hat einen ABEND gefunden.

  • Die Verbindung zwischen dem TP und dem PU 2.1-Knoten wurde unterbrochen (LAN-Fehler).

  • Die SnaBase auf dem Computer des TP ist auf ein ABEND gestoßen.

    Der Systemadministrator sollte das Fehlerprotokoll untersuchen, um den Grund für den ABEND zu ermitteln.

F004

AP_COMM_SUBSYSTEM_NOT_LOADED
Eine erforderliche Komponente konnte nicht geladen werden oder wurde abgebrochen, während der Befehl verarbeitet wurde. So konnte die Kommunikation nicht stattfinden. Wenden Sie sich an den Systemadministrator, um Korrekturmaßnahmen zu ergreifen.

F005

AP_CONV_BUSY
Es kann jeweils nur ein herausragendes Konversationsverb bei jeder Unterhaltung aktiv sein.

F006

AP_THREAD_BLOCKING
Der aufrufende Thread befindet sich bereits in einem Blockierungsaufruf.

F008

AP_INVALID_VERB_SEGMENT
Der Verbsteuerungsblock (Verb Control Block, VCB) wurde über das Ende des Datensegments hinaus erweitert.

F011

AP_UNERWARTETER_DOS_FEHLER
Das Betriebssystem hat beim Verarbeiten eines APPC-Aufrufs vom lokalen TP einen Fehler an APPC zurückgegeben. Der Rückgabecode des Betriebssystems wird über die secondary_rc zurückgegeben. Es liegt in der Intel Byte-Swap-Reihenfolge vor. Wenn das Problem weiterhin besteht, wenden Sie sich an den Systemadministrator.

F015

AP_STACK_TOO_SMALL
Die Stapelgröße der Anwendung ist zu klein, um das Verb auszuführen. Erhöhen Sie die Stapelgröße Ihrer Anwendung.

F020

AP_UNGÜLTIGER_SCHLÜSSEL
Der angegebene Schlüssel war falsch.